Transaction 258a81fc52cb4eaf9e07cb752499cf1268f804f81ae72b0143d5f1beff7bb821

1 Input
2 Outputs
  • 258a81fc52cb4eaf9e07cb752499cf1268f804f81ae72b0143d5f1beff7bb821:0
  • value  66500
    address  15PEdUskCpzbWy3Z6qEvhHjKfheZNPU9e4
  • 258a81fc52cb4eaf9e07cb752499cf1268f804f81ae72b0143d5f1beff7bb821:1
  • value  5804091
    address  34pqbYjupuWXsF5WK3jExFkshDACAnWw4i